A seven-month WNBA offseason leaves us with an extra sharp hunger for hoops, especially for the defending champion, star-studded New York Liberty.
Their preseason contest on Friday night against the Connecticut Sun will be their first action since Game 5 of the WNBA Finals, 204 days earlier. The team’s path to repeating will be quite differentthan the one to the first championship in franchise history, given Betnijah Laney-Hamilton’s season-long absence, Kayla Thornton’s departure, and June’s EuroBasket competition, which will temporarily pluck three key pieces from the rotation.
Alas, none of our questions will be answered over two preseason games, the second of which will take place at University of Oregon, the alma mater of Sabrina Ionescu and Nyara Sabally.
